A Louisiana appellate court ruled that an employer’s failure to produce a witness to counter a worker’s claim as to a miscalculation of her indemnity benefits justified an award of benefits based on the claimed wages, as well as an assessment of penalties, fees and interest.
Case: Jackson v. Aramark Healthcare Services, No. 17-503, 02/07/2018, published.
Facts and procedural history: Chelsea Jackson worked for Aramark Healthcare Services. She suffered injuries in a fall down a small flight of steps while at work.
